Railways' April-May revenue up 3.34 percent

 

 

New Delhi, June 16, 2009

 

The total earnings of Indian Railways during April-May stood at around Rs.13,709 crore, compared to Rs.13,266 crore earned during the corresponding period last year, reflecting an increase of 3.34 percent.

 

Freight earnings have gone up 2.34 percent to Rs.9,340 crore during the period under review from about Rs.9,127 crore in the year-ago period, the railways ministry said.

 

Total passenger revenue earnings during first two months of the current year stood at Rs.3,831 crore, registering an increase of 5.35 percent from Rs.3,637 crore earned in the corresponding period in 2008-09.

 

Passenger bookings rose to 1,204 million from 1,155 million - an increase of 4.19 percent.
